Forget big clunky bags – Pack light and secure
When starting out with my photography hobby I naively purchased a very large bag. I assumed, and rightly so, that I would have more equipment in the future so I might as well go for a bigger bag.This logic didn’t take into account the 80/90% of the time I would only want to bring a select amount of equipment. Lugging around a huge bag all the time, especially when hiking isn’t ideal.For me, this bag is the perfect solution for almost all of my work.___Small and versatile___I bring my camera, small tripod, a few lenses and flash and still have room to spare other things like my tablet, phone etc.Now my bigger bag is just used for storing item I rarely use.___Waterproof___The water proof cover has been really handy and the straps for over chest and waist are great for hiking and climbing to get that perfect shot!___Secure___The straps are a real highlight for me. OI do a lot of work in mountains and that sometimes includes climbing. The straps give me the added security and centre of gravity. The sections are well padded and overall the bag is very light but sturdy. I wouldn’t be afraid to drop it, even with all my equipment in it!Don’t be put off by the size, for me its biggest selling point!I highly recommend this bag, and one of my close friends has also purchased one after seeing it!Nb.
